Overview
Principal Cyber Security Analyst - Splunk | ISO27001 | MITRE ATT&CK | Incident Response
Location: Melbourne (Hybrid) 3 days on-site
Type: Permanent
Salary: Competitive + Super
A leading organisation is seeking a Principal Cyber Security Analyst to lead advanced cyber defence and incident response initiatives. You'll work alongside a high-performing team of cyber security professionals, providing operational leadership and technical expertise across threat detection, response, and tooling uplift.
This role offers autonomy, strategic influence, and the opportunity to shape cyber maturity across a complex enterprise environment. You'll collaborate with internal stakeholders and external partners to operationalise security controls, uplift SOC capabilities, and drive continuous improvement.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ead cyber defence and incident response operations across enterprise environments
- Mentor and guide a team of cyber analysts, fostering a collaborative and high-performance culture
- Monitor security systems and networks, investigate incidents, and implement mitigation strategies
- Analyse logs and threat intelligence to identify risks and develop response plans
- Evaluate and implement new security tools, technologies, and processes
- Align security operations with ISO27001, NIST, CIS, and ASD ISM frameworks
- Champion continuous improvement and uplift of SOC tooling and processes
- Collaborate with internal teams and external partners to enhance cyber resilience
- Stay current with threat trends, APT groups, and emerging attack vectors
Key Requirements
- Postgraduate qualifications or equivalent experience in cyber security or IT
- Certifications such as CISSP, GIAC, or ITIL Practitioner
- Strong experience with SIEM platforms (Splunk preferred), SPL, and threat hunting
- Deep understanding of MITRE ATT&CK, threat modelling, and operational threat intelligence
- Proven ability to lead incident response and vulnerability management programs
- Strong stakeholder engagement and consulting skills
- Experience with ISO27001/27002, NIST, CIS frameworks
- Ability to adapt to evolving threats and technologies
Additional Info
- Hybrid work model with occasional travel to other sites
- On-call support may be required via roster rotation
- National Police Check required
